Output 891ed333cb6d8920291532754411fb2041f1181a2454e915315d16bada939a35:29

value
387420489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2bab776675669fb9eed09f2731d2d541157f4e831cf80d92d291348bca24182
address
bc1pu2atwan82e5lh8hdp8e8x8fd2sg40a8gx88cpkfd9yf5309zgxpqwpf2zf
transaction
891ed333cb6d8920291532754411fb2041f1181a2454e915315d16bada939a35